Oregon
Filing Fee at a Glance
Oregon charges $100 to file Articles of Organization — in the $50–$100 tier. Total estimated first-year cost: $200.
Annual Report & Ongoing Costs
Oregon requires an annual report with a $100 fee. Due: anniversary date.
Additional Notes
No sales tax in Oregon. Oregon imposes a Corporate Activity Tax (CAT) on commercial activity over $1 million.
